From Wednesday 29 October there will be a temporary congestion charge on six roads in Oxford.

Oxford Congestion Charge Locations

Cars with permits and all other vehicles can pass through the charge locations for free. If you don’t have a permit you will need to pay £5 per day to drive a car through the six congestion charge locations.
 
Permits are available for residents, blue badge holders, community health and care workers, mobile traders and many other groups.

You can apply for and manage your permit online. Register for a free online account, select the permit you are applying for and upload the required documents.

If you’re unable to apply online, you can apply by phone – 01865 519800.
